Video of monkey charging at Oklahoma man before attack on neighbor goes viral

An Ardmore man's video of a loose monkey who later attacked a woman in neighboring Dickson has gone viral on TikTok. Randal Flinn's footage shows the monkey on his front porch.

"What's a monkey doing in Oklahoma?" Flinn is heard asking aloud on the other side of a screen door.

Flinn then opens his door as the monkey heads toward a dog in his yard, and then quickly shuts the door as the animal charges toward him.

Flinn's TikTok account features the video as his first share on the social media platform. As of this writing, it has received 2.8 million views in the first two days of being posted.

A second video by Flinn on his TikTok features Flinn's voice behind the camera, showing police at the scene of who he says is a neighbor's home where a woman was allegedly bitten by the monkey.

Brittany Parker told KOKH told KOKH she was attacked by the monkey, saying she suffered injuries to her and face and would surgery to her ear, too.

Dickson police responded to the scene, where the monkey was shot and killed by Parker's family members. Police have not identified the animal's owner.

In Oklahoma, it is legal to own a monkey without a special license. Certain primates, like chimpanzees for example, do require special permission from the state as they are endangered animals.
